  • O'Reilly identified Google as "the standard bearer for Web 2.0", and pointed out the differences between it and predecessors such as Netscape, which tried to adapt for the web the business model established by Microsoft and other PC software suppliers.
  • Google "began its life as a native web application, never sold or packaged, but delivered as a service, with customers paying, directly or indirectly.
  • perpetual beta, as O'Reilly later dubbed it
  • ...13 more annotations...
  • Perhaps the most important breakthrough was Google's willingness to relinquish control of the user-end of the transaction, instead of trying to lock them in with proprietary technology and restrictive licensing
  • O'Reilly took a second Web 2.0 principle from Peer-to-Peer pioneer BitTorrent, which works by completely decentralising the delivery of files, with every client also functioning as a server. The more popular a file, is, the faster it can be served, since there are more users providing bandwidth and fragments of the file. Thus, "the service automatically gets better the more people use it".
  • Taking another model from open source, users are treated as "co-developers", actively encouraged to contribute, and monitored in real time to see what they are using, and how they are using it.
  • "Until Web 2.0 the learning curve to creating websites was quite high, complex, and a definite barrier to entry," says the third of our triumvirate of Tims, Tim Bray, director of Web Technologies at Sun Microsystems.
  • Web 2.0 takes some of its philosophical underpinning from James Surowiecki's book The Wisdom of Crowds, which asserts that the aggregated insights of large groups of diverse people can provide better answers and innovations than individual experts.
  • In practice, even fewer than 1% of people may be making a useful contribution - but these may be the most energetic and able members of a very large community. In 2006 1,000 people, just 0.003% of its users, contributed around two-thirds of Wikipedia's edits.
  • Ajax speeds up response times by enabling just part of a page to be updated, instead of downloading a whole new page. Nielsen's objections include that this breaks the "back" button - the ability to get back to where you've been, which Nielsen says is the second most used feature in Web navigation.
  • "Everybody who has a Web browser has got that platform," says Berners-Lee, in a podcast available on IBM's developerWorks site. "So the nice thing about it is when you do code up an Ajax implementation, other people can take it and play with it."
  • Web 2.0 is a step on the way to the Semantic Web, a long-standing W3C initiative to create a standards-based framework able to understand the links between data which is related in the real world, and follow that data wherever it resides, regardless of application and database boundaries.
  • The problem with Web 2.0, Pemberton says, is that it "partitions the web into a number of topical sub-webs, and locks you in, thereby reducing the value of the network as a whole."
  • How do you decide which social networking site to join? he asks. "Do you join several and repeat the work?" With the Semantic Web's Resource Description Framework (RDF), you won't need to sign up to separate networks, and can keep ownership of your data. "You could describe it as a CSS for meaning: it allows you to add a small layer of markup to your page that adds machine-readable semantics."
  • The problems with Web 2.0 lock-in which Pemberton describes, were illustrated when a prominent member of the active 1%, Robert Scoble, ran a routine called Plaxo to try to extract details of his 5,000 contacts from Facebook, in breach of the site's terms of use, and had his account disabled. Although he has apparently had his account reinstated, the furore has made the issue of Web 2.0 data ownership and portability fiercely topical.
  • when Google announced its OpenSocial set of APIs, which will enable developers to create portable applications and bridges between social networking websites, Facebook was not among those taking part.   • the tracking of consumers has grown both far more pervasive and far more intrusive than is realized by all but a handful of people in the vanguard of the industry. • The study found that the nation's 50 top websites on average installed 64 pieces of tracking technology onto the computers of visitors, usually with no warning. A dozen sites each installed more than a hundred. The nonprofit Wikipedia installed none.
  • the Journal found new tools that scan in real time what people are doing on a Web page, then instantly assess location, income, shopping interests and even medical conditions. Some tools surreptitiously re-spawn themselves even after users try to delete them. • These profiles of individuals, constantly refreshed, are bought and sold on stock-market-like exchanges that have sprung up in the past 18 months.
  • Advertisers once primarily bought ads on specific Web pages—a car ad on a car site. Now, advertisers are paying a premium to follow people around the Internet, wherever they go, with highly specific marketing messages.
  • ...22 more annotations...
  • "It is a sea change in the way the industry works," says Omar Tawakol, CEO of BlueKai. "Advertisers want to buy access to people, not Web pages."
  • The Journal found that Microsoft Corp.'s popular Web portal, MSN.com, planted a tracking file packed with data: It had a prediction of a surfer's age, ZIP Code and gender, plus a code containing estimates of income, marital status, presence of children and home ownership, according to the tracking company that created the file, Targus Information Corp.
  • Tracking is done by tiny files and programs known as "cookies," "Flash cookies" and "beacons." They are placed on a computer when a user visits a website. U.S. courts have ruled that it is legal to deploy the simplest type, cookies, just as someone using a telephone might allow a friend to listen in on a conversation. Courts haven't ruled on the more complex trackers.
  • tracking companies sometimes hide their files within free software offered to websites, or hide them within other tracking files or ads. When this happens, websites aren't always aware that they're installing the files on visitors' computers.
  • Often staffed by "quants," or math gurus with expertise in quantitative analysis, some tracking companies use probability algorithms to try to pair what they know about a person's online behavior with data from offline sources about household income, geography and education, among other things. The goal is to make sophisticated assumptions in real time—plans for a summer vacation, the likelihood of repaying a loan—and sell those conclusions.
  • Consumer tracking is the foundation of an online advertising economy that racked up $23 billion in ad spending last year. Tracking activity is exploding. Researchers at AT&T Labs and Worcester Polytechnic Institute last fall found tracking technology on 80% of 1,000 popular sites, up from 40% of those sites in 2005.
  • The Journal found tracking files that collect sensitive health and financial data. On Encyclopaedia Britannica Inc.'s dictionary website Merriam-Webster.com, one tracking file from Healthline Networks Inc., an ad network, scans the page a user is viewing and targets ads related to what it sees there.
    • Barbara Lindsey
       
      Tracking you an targeting ads to you on a popular dictionary site!
  • Beacons, also known as "Web bugs" and "pixels," are small pieces of software that run on a Web page. They can track what a user is doing on the page, including what is being typed or where the mouse is moving.
  • The majority of sites examined by the Journal placed at least seven beacons from outside companies. Dictionary.com had the most, 41, including several from companies that track health conditions and one that says it can target consumers by dozens of factors, including zip code and race.
  • After the Journal contacted the company, it cut the number of networks it uses and beefed up its privacy policy to more fully disclose its practices.
  • Flash cookies can also be used by data collectors to re-install regular cookies that a user has deleted. This can circumvent a user's attempt to avoid being tracked online. Adobe condemns the practice.
  • Most sites examined by the Journal installed no Flash cookies. Comcast.net installed 55.
